What I wish I'd asked my attorney in our very first conversation
Looking back at my initial consultation, there were a few questions I didn't think to ask that would have set clearer expectations from the start. Sharing them for anyone about to have that first conversation. What's your specific division of labor going to be — what will you draft versus what will I need to gather and organize myself? How do you typically communicate during the process, and what's a realistic response time I should expect? What's your experience specifically with cases similar to mine (same general field, similar evidence profile), not just EB-1A generally? And practically: what does your fee structure actually cover, and what happens if the case needs an RFE response — is that included or additional? None of these are unusual or awkward questions to ask a professional you're about to work closely with for months — a good attorney should welcome them. I just hadn't thought to ask upfront, and ended up clarifying some of this reactively partway through instead of having clear expectations from day one.
